About Harmony Intermediate Center

Harmony Intermediate Center is a public middle school in Belleville, IL, part of Harmony Emge SD 175. Harmony Intermediate Center serves approximately 205 students, and covers grades 4th-6th, and has a 20.5:1 student-teacher ratio. Harmony Intermediate Center has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.4 out of 10 and ranks #1,730 of 3,813 schools in IL.

Structured state assessment records for Harmony Intermediate Center show 16%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2015-2021) and 26%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2015-2022).

What Parents Should Know

Harmony Intermediate Center runs 20.5:1 students to teachers, above the national average. That often means bigger classes. Ask how the school supports kids who need extra help, and whether there are teaching assistants or small-group time.
